The Installation Process
The installation of a back door involves numerous actions, which can differ depending on the intricacy of the task and the type of door being installed. Below is a general outline of a typical installation process:
- Consultation: The installer evaluates the area where the door will be put and goes over style alternatives with the homeowner.
- Elimination of the Old Door: The old door and its frame are thoroughly removed, making sure that no damage is done to surrounding areas.
- Preparation: The opening for the new door is prepared. This might include adjustments to the framing to guarantee an appropriate fit.
- Installation of the New Door: The new door is installed according to the producer's directions and building regulations. This consists of securing it to the frame and guaranteeing it runs properly.
- Weatherproofing: Proper sealing and weatherstripping are applied to minimize drafts and avoid water infiltration.
- Ending up Touches: The installer will make last adjustments, set up hardware, and ensure whatever is working properly. A clean-up of the work area is also performed.

FAQs About Back Door Installation
Q1: How much does it cost to set up a back door?A1: The cost can vary commonly based on the kind of door, materials, and labor. Usually, installation costs can range from ₤ 500 to ₤ 1,500.
Q2: How long does it take to set up a back entrance?A2: Most setups can be finished within a few hours, however more complicated projects may take a complete day.
Q3: What kind of back entrance is best for energy performance?A3: Doors made from fiberglass or steel normally provide much better insulation and energy efficiency than wood alternatives.
Q4: Can I install a back entrance myself?A4: While DIY installation is possible, it's recommended to hire a qualified installer to make sure security and compliance with local codes.
Q5: What should I do if my back entrance is not closing appropriately?A5: If a door is not closing correctly, it could be due to inappropriate installation or issues with the door frame. Consult a professional for a comprehensive evaluation.
